Skycaptain1000 said,
Don’t see how and why the pilot is to be blamed. He did not miscalculate. He used 175 lbs per passenger for weight and balance check. That was the number that the entire industry used for weight and balance calculations. After this incident it has been revised to 200 lbs per passenger. He was just doing what he was told to. …..
